KingSpec XG 7000 512GB PCIe 4.0 NVMe 1.4 SSD
This 512GB internal solid-state drive uses 3D NAND flash and a PCIe 4.0 x4 interface with NVMe 1.4 protocol. It targets gamers, content creators and power users who need fast boot times and quick application loading on desktops, laptops or a PS5 console.
Graphene heat spreader on M.2 2280 form factor
The drive includes an integrated graphene-based heat spreader measuring 2.1mm in height, keeping the 80.0mm by 22.0mm module within standard single-sided clearance. No separate heatsink is required, simplifying installation in thin laptops or the PS5 expansion slot while maintaining stable temperatures under load.
Verify M.2 key, PCIe generation and heatsink
Confirm your motherboard or laptop provides an M.2 2280 M-key slot wired for PCIe 4.0 x4 to reach the rated 7400 MBps read and 6600 MBps write speeds. The drive is backward compatible with PCIe 3.0 at reduced throughput. Ensure the 2.1mm module height fits your device’s thermal pad or cover specifications before ordering.
